Content Strategies That Work for Singapore Audiences

Creating scroll-stopping content requires understanding what resonates with Singaporean Instagram users. In 2026, authenticity remains paramount, but production quality has also increased significantly across the platform.

Reels: The Cornerstone of Instagram Visibility

Instagram Reels continue to dominate engagement in 2026. For Singapore businesses, creating short-form video content is no longer optional—it’s essential for visibility. The algorithm actively promotes Reels to users who don’t already follow you, providing massive organic reach potential.

Successful Reels for Singapore audiences often feature local elements: Singapore street food, local events, MRT station references, or Singlish phrases. This localization creates immediate relatability. Tutorial Reels, behind-the-scenes peeks, quick tips, and trending challenges all perform well when adapted to your brand’s voice.

Technical quality matters. Ensure good lighting, stable footage, and clear audio. Most Singapore users consume content on mobile devices, so optimize for vertical viewing. Add captions since many users watch without sound, and captions significantly improve engagement rates.

Stories: Building Intimate Connections

Instagram Stories offer unique opportunities for real-time engagement. In 2026, the features have expanded to include polls, quizzes, sliders, questions, and interactive stickers. These tools enable two-way conversations that strengthen community bonds.

Singapore users appreciate brands that are responsive and approachable. Use Stories to answer common questions, address customer concerns, or simply share your daily operations. A bakery sharing morning preparations or a consultancy showing team brainstorming sessions humanizes your brand.

Interactive features like polls (“kaya or butter toast?”) and quizzes create engagement while providing valuable market insights. Question stickers invite direct messages and can uncover customer pain points or desires. The fleeting nature of Stories encourages more casual, authentic content that followers find refreshing compared to polished feed posts.

Audience Targeting in the Singapore Market

Instagram’s parent company Meta provides robust targeting capabilities. Singapore businesses can target based on demographics, interests, behaviors, and custom audiences. For local businesses, geographic targeting is particularly valuable—you can target users within specific neighborhoods, around MRT stations, or within radius of your physical location.

Lookalike audiences are powerful for expanding your reach. By uploading your existing customer list or engaging follower data, you can find new users with similar characteristics who are likely interested in your offerings. Singapore’s relatively small market makes lookalike audiences especially valuable for efficient scaling.

Retargeting is equally important. Set up pixels on your website to capture visitors who didn’t convert. Create custom audiences from people who have engaged with your content, watched your Reels, or visited specific product pages. These warm audiences are far more likely to convert than cold audiences.

Ad Formats That Drive Results

Instagram offers various ad formats, each suited to different objectives. For brand awareness, Reels ads and carousel ads work well. For driving traffic, photo ads with strong visuals and clear CTAs perform effectively. For conversions, collection ads and shopping ads showcase products directly within the feed.

Video ads in 2026 should be short, engaging, and optimized for mobile. Hook viewers within the first second. Deliver value quickly. Include captions and ensure your message is clear even without sound. Singapore users are sophisticated consumers who quickly scroll past content that doesn’t immediately capture their interest.

A/B testing is essential for optimization. Test different creatives, headlines, audiences, and call-to-actions. What works for one business may not work for another, so continuous testing and iteration are key to maximizing your advertising ROI.

Instagram Analytics: Measuring What Matters

Instagram provides comprehensive analytics through Instagram Insights. Focus on metrics that align with your business objectives rather than vanity metrics like follower count.

For brand awareness, track reach and impression metrics. For engagement, monitor likes, comments, saves, and shares. Saves are particularly valuable in 2026 as they indicate genuine interest and high-quality content. For conversions, set up proper tracking to measure website clicks, sign-ups, and purchases attributable to Instagram.

Review your analytics weekly to identify content themes and posting times that resonate with your audience. Data-driven decisions lead to continuous improvement and better results over time.
